pam_chroot is a Linux PAM module that allows
a user to be chrooted in auth, account, or
session. Its configuration employs a flexible
syntax that allows users to be selectively
chrooted based upon usernames or group
membership.

This change includes minor bugfixes in the source, a revamp of the code formatting, and adjustments to the Makefile that make it respect externally-set environment variables.
This release added support for extended regular expressions, user/group matching, and back-references in the chroot directory construction. Memory leaks were fixed.
